US Patent No. 8,927,479 B2; The Clorox Company has been awarded US patent coverage for a hard surface aerosol cleaning composition with improved bathroom soil removal. The composition, which develops a foam upon being dispensed, consists of a nonionic surfactant; a cationic surfactant; a water-soluble or dispersible organic solvent having a vapor pressure of at least 0.001 mm Hg at 25°C; a chelating agent; a propellant, wherein 30% to 100% by weight of the propellant is n-butane; and water. Optionally, it can also contain one or more of the following adjuncts selected from the group consisting of: builders, buffers, fragrances, perfumes, thickeners, dyes, colorants, pigments, foaming stabilizers, water-insoluble organic solvents, corrosion inhibitors, hydrotropes, and mixtures thereof.
